Pidyon HaBen Timing and Prayer Disruption Cherem

From: Rabbi Moshe Sofer

To: Rabbi David

Description

Two questions are addressed: whether Pidyon HaBen may be performed on day thirty once the astronomical month has elapsed, and the meaning of Rabbeinu Gershom's cherem regarding disrupting prayer services. The Chasam Sofer rules that Pidyon HaBen must wait until day thirty-one, since we count days not hours for months.

Source: Shu"t Chasam Sofer OC §81
